How they compare

Sri Lanka currently reports 152,595 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re against 131,396 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re in Romania, a difference of 21,199 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re.

That makes Sri Lanka's figure about 1.2 times Romania's.

Across all 9 years both countries report, Sri Lanka has been ahead every year.

Romania ranks 62nd and Sri Lanka ranks 59th of 166 countries.

Sri Lanka has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
